WebUp to 3cm long [200]. It can be dried, ground into a powder and used as a thickening in stews etc or mixed with cereals for making bread. The seed contains bitter tannins, these can be leached out by thoroughly washing the seed in running water though many minerals will also be lost [183]. http://bioimages.vanderbilt.edu/pages/compare-oaks.htm

Web10 de abr. de 2024 · Southern red oak is an excellent large, durable shade tree which reaches 60 to 80 feet in height with a large, rounded canopy when it is open-grown. The deciduous, shiny green leaves are 5- to 9-inches-long by 4- to 5-inches-wide, with the terminal lobe much longer and narrower than the others.
